<h2>Ashdod vs Bnei Sakhnin: Early Season Momentum Clash</h2> <h3>Team Form Analysis</h3> **Ashdod** enters this fixture riding high after their impressive 2-1 comeback victory away to Hapoel Jerusalem, demonstrating the character and resilience that will serve them well at home. Eugene Ansah's equalizing goal in the 54th minute, followed by Ilay Tamam's winner in the 74th, showcased their second-half potency and never-say-die attitude. The fact they managed to overturn a 1-0 deficit speaks volumes about their mental strength under new management. **Bnei Sakhnin**, meanwhile, suffered heartbreak in their home opener against Beitar Jerusalem. Despite Basil Khuri's equalizer in the 44th minute canceling out Omer Atzili's early strike, they conceded a crucial goal right on the stroke of halftime to lose 1-2. This pattern of defensive lapses at critical moments will be a major concern heading into their first away fixture of the campaign. <h3>Historical Context and Tactical Setup</h3> The head-to-head record heavily favors Ashdod, who have won 15 of their last 47 encounters with Sakhnin. However, recent meetings have produced a notable 67% draw rate, suggesting these fixtures often develop into tight, cagey affairs. Both managers will likely prioritize defensive solidity while seeking to exploit the opposition's early-season vulnerabilities. Ashdod's tactical approach under their coaching staff emphasizes late-game pressure, evidenced by their 100% second-half goal conversion rate in the opener. Goalkeeper Karol Niemczycki, despite conceding once, showed good shot-stopping ability and will be crucial in maintaining defensive organization. The midfield partnership of Roei Gordana and the promising Ilay Tamam provides both experience and youth. <h3>Key Player Battles</h3> **Central Midfield Duel**: Ashdod's Roei Gordana, a 35-year-old veteran with 160 minutes already played across competitions, brings crucial experience against Sakhnin's Muhamad Badarna, who earned a 6.2 rating despite the defeat. Badarna's two tackles and one interception suggest he'll be key to disrupting Ashdod's rhythm. **Attacking Threats**: Ilay Tamam's winner last week makes him Ashdod's primary goal threat, while Sakhnin will look to Basil Khuri, whose impressive 7.7 rating included two shots on target and the team's only goal. The 22-year-old showed excellent composure in front of goal and will be eager to continue his scoring form. **Defensive Stability**: Sakhnin's goalkeeper Muhammad Abu Nil's outstanding 8.5 rating, including seven saves, suggests he single-handedly kept the scoreline respectable against Beitar Jerusalem. He'll need another stellar performance to frustrate an Ashdod attack that found their rhythm in the second half of their opener. <h3>Weather and Venue Conditions</h3> Perfect weather conditions are expected at Yud-Alef Stadium, with temperatures in the high 20s Celsius providing ideal playing conditions for both teams. The lack of adverse weather should allow both sides to implement their preferred tactical approaches without environmental interference. <h3>Season Expectations and Motivation</h3> Both clubs enter the season with modest expectations after finishing in the lower half last campaign. Ashdod's early momentum could prove crucial in establishing a positive atmosphere at home, while Sakhnin will be desperate to avoid starting the season with two consecutive defeats. The psychological advantage clearly lies with the hosts, who have already demonstrated their ability to grind out results when trailing. <h3>Prediction and Final Thoughts</h3> This encounter presents a classic case of early-season momentum meeting desperation. Ashdod's superior start, combined with their historical dominance and home advantage, makes them clear favorites. However, Sakhnin's attacking potential, evidenced by their ability to score against quality opposition, ensures this won't be straightforward. Expect a tightly contested affair with Ashdod's second-half strength ultimately proving decisive in a narrow victory that continues their positive start to the campaign.
